The Role
The Territory Sales Representative grows assigned-route sales by managing retail customer relationships, prospecting for new business, supporting sales drivers, negotiating displays and promotions, resolving service issues, monitoring out-of-stock reports, and meeting sales goals. The role requires frequent store visits, customer communication, route and inventory coordination, safety compliance, and occasional physical handling of products. Candidates must have a valid driver’s license, clean driving record, strong communication skills, and at least one year of retail or field sales experience.

Job Brief:

The Territory Sales Representative is responsible for the growth of sales of assigned routes. The ideal candidate will establish, maintain, and develop business, social and civic relationships with customers and sales drivers in the assigned territory to maximum profitability.

Responsibilities:

  • Establish and maintain collaborative relationships with sales drivers, store managers, and key customer decision makers.
  • Ensure the company drivers understand the expectation and communicate how he/she will execute and align the goals of the organization. This includes weekly updates. Send all training documentation to the Human Resources Department.
  • Ensure sales expectations are met, while delivering high-quality customer service to various customer accounts.
  • Identify leads, manage prospects, and acquire new business.
  • Travel to customers and potential customer’s facilities providing them with information and support as required to secure and maintain business.
  • Grow business by anticipating customer needs, determine appropriate solutions to business problems, and provide an overall high level of customer service.
  • Establish, and maintain, call frequency on major retail chain District Managers to support sales and service levels.
  • Build rapport and trust with all store key management personnel through frequent visits and communication.
  • Prepare tailored selling plan with in-depth knowledge of specific retail customer and full product portfolio to influence growth opportunities.
  • Follow through on agreed upon sales/service commitments to exceed store management expectations.
  • Develop and maintain a thorough knowledge of company products and pricing structure.
  • Manage assigned company-generated leads.
  • Complete scheduled and in-person prospecting activities to establish first and follow-up appointments with key decision makers.
  • Communicate weekly (or daily) with Division Sales Manager on sales activities, progress on goals, and status of prospective customers.
  • Periodically visit stores to identify service strengths and opportunities.
  • Ensure weekly customer visits to negotiate ads and gain more space/displays; minimum of 2 visits per week.
  • Attend grand openings and store anniversaries.
  • Review weekly Out-of-Stock (OOS) report to adequately address deficiencies.
  • Use effective Time Management Skills to service stores and establish customer relationships with all customers accordingly. This is a critical issue with our major customers. Our customers must have someone to contact if there are issues in their stores.
  • Establish a plan in case you need to organize, re-route, or run a route, if needed. Ensure route paperwork is organized.
  • Ensure stores are well serviced without credits.
  • Follow all procedures on the three steps to get in the back of truck or get out.
  • Attend all weekly required safety meetings.
  • Ensure all equipment is in good-working condition.
  • Ensure truck inventory is in compliance.
  • Make sure all company procedures are followed including the policy on personal hygiene.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
